1. Robert and Kev caught by Aaron in Emmerdale spoilers
Robert is shocked when he finds Kev at Keepers talking to Victoria. Vic demands Robert has to tell Aaron the truth, but Robert still stalls.
Kev is staying with Claudette and Charles who he meets at the cafe. But he also sees Aaron at the cafe and Robert is horrified his two lives have collided.
He covers by downplaying his relationship with Kev to Aaron, but Victoria has had enough of the lying and tells Robert he has to do something. He promises to end things with Kev.
But he doesn’t get chance to do it before Aaron announces their reunion to the Woolpack…

Robert later tries to gently break up with Kev. He talks to his husband about his worries over Kev’s aggression. Kev promises to be a better man, but is suspicious something isn’t right.
Kev gives Robert an expensive watch and kisses him in public. Robert is horrfied when he realises Aaron has seen the whole thing. How will he explain this?

2. Car accident sees Jimmy mowed down – by Joe Tate
Joe is furious when the police drop the investigation into Carl King. Dawn wants to move on, but will Joe’s desire for revenge allow it?
Later on, while driving Joe is distracted and accidentally hits someone. He’s horrified when he realises it’s Jimmy. Caleb has witnessed the whole thing and it forces Joe to call an ambulance.
But as Nicola rushes to Jimmy’s side in hospital, she is shocked to see Joe being questioned. Sure it was delieberate, Nicola doesn’t want to hear Joe’s protestations it was an accident. She vows to make a statement and see him pay.

3. A woman is found at the Depot in Emmerdale spoilers
While Joe is at the Depot talking to Caleb about the Jimmy situation, they hear a noise. Before long they find a petrified young woman named Anya in one of the vans. When Ruby arrives, she wants to know what is going on.
Ruby takes matters into her own hands when Anya runs off as the police arrive. She gets her checked out by Dr Liam, who tells her to report Anya to the authorities. But as Caleb and Ruby discuss what to do, will they do the right thing?

4. Dylan trapped by Ray in Emmerdale spoilers
Keen to get closer to April again, Marlon checks up on her via Dylan. He even offers him a shift in the Woolpack kitchen to try and get more info on his daughter.
Dylan is thrilled when Paddy gifts him a rally driving experience as a congratulations for passing his driving test. However, Ray soon brings him back down to earth when he tells Dylan to steal the Depot driving schedules. Dylan is almost busted by Jai, but manages to get his hands on what Ray wants.
Ray then offers Dylan a job, but Dylan turns it down to go rally driving with Paddy. Furious Ray reminds him his debt is mounting up and he needs to find a way to pay it.

5. Vinny blindsided by Gabby
Mandy catches Gabby checking Vinny’s phone to see who Vinny has been texting and she begs Mandy not to tell Vinny. Mandy is worried about the newlyweds thinking it’s all over before it’s begun.
With Mandy’s words ringing in her ear, Gabby comes to a decision. She announces it to Vinny and it’s huge. He is totally stunned, but will he be on board with it?

6. Claudette brings Liam to task
Liam launches his prostate checking campaign and during a team meeting at the surgery, Claudette reveals she lost a brother to the disease.
She is horrified to learn Charles has been lying about getting checked every few years and vows to sort him out.
Meanwhile, Liam is thrilled to see so many men coming to a prostate exam. It’s all down to Cain’s help, but it could save lives.
